I thought I'd enjoy this combination, but as soon as I picked it up, I realized it would be a chore. The brush handle is securely attached to the dust pan handle, and the only way to get it out is to pull on a rubber hang loop on the back or to pull the brush forward, grabbing around the bristles. It also won't come out because it's caught in the dust pan's notch. I simply do not believe the hang loop will withstand repeated use. The bristles in the brush were also starting to splay after a couple of trial removals. You could move the brush forward a little to reveal the handle, but this defeats the purpose of the loop. This may look nice, but I don't think it will last; all they had to do was extend the handle an inch or two to make it easier to grip the brush, but they chose form over function and cost savings.

This dustpan set stands out from the crowd thanks to two design features. First, the brush's triangular head, which effectively manages corners with the help of soft but sturdy bristles; Second, the comb is effective for cat littler. The brush is effectively cleaned of debris, including hair, that inevitably gets stuck to it, thanks to teeth on the pan itself. The non-sticky, rubbery texture A bonus point is awarded for the brush handle's slip texture.
